Dr. Waldron performed Merlin's angiogram on January 19th. It looks like there haven't been any bleeds, and maybe only one tiny aneurysm. The pictures were a bit scary, even though the news was (relatively) good and what we expected to hear. It looked like someone had spilled ink in a big puddle in the middle of the left side of her brain. This view made the damage look more extensive than it had in the MRI.

We went to see Dr. Kerr (a pediatric neurologist at Dell Children's) to get an EEG and try to determine whether her "episodes" (numbness on the right side of her body and headache) were seizures. The EEG looked perfectly normal, but a normal read couldn't rule out the possibility of seizures, so he prescribed Topamax since it is known to treat both seizures and migraines.

We are gathering medical records and images to send to Dr. Lawton and Dr Gupta at UCSF. (We were referred to McDermott, but he doesn't treat children. Dr. Gupta is their pediatric gamma person, although they will all sit in on the pre-conference and discuss potential courses of action.) It's been a little frustrating getting the appointment set up - Dr Waldron sent over the films and gave me the phone numbers to call, and it seemed like it was going to be pretty straightforward, but when I called, they were in a tizzy about her being 13, and they wanted ALL her records, and they sounded skeptical about our insurance. So, I'm working on all those things.

In the meantime, we are adjusting, and Merlin seems to be doing well.
